DIT looking for cash injection
TOOWOOMBA-BASED ag tech company Direct Injection Technologies has opened shares in its disruptive supplement technology business, allowing everyday Aussie investors the chance to invest in the first ag-tech equity crowdfunding offer in Australia on equity crowdfunding platform Equitise.
DIT is the world’s leading expert in water medication for the livestock and grazing industries.
Valued at $10 million, the fast-growing startup is offering a 10 per cent stake in its business to retail investors through the Equitise platform.
Following an acquisition of its biggest competitor last year, DIT is the world’s leading water supplement technology company and is revolutionising the way livestock in Australia are supplemented and managed.
In a rare investment opportunity starting at $250, DIT will enable every day Australians in both city and regional areas a unique opportunity to help scale and grow its leading innovation supplements range and product line. DIT is turning to equity crowdfunding to fund growth, hire staff, set up micro factories and invest in research and development.
DIT owner Mark Peart said it was his unrelenting passion and drive to convert the enormous opportunity that water supplementation brought to the Australian livestock industry that inspired him to turn to equity crowdfunding.
